活动介绍
file-type

基于Vue3.0与Element的多功能后台管理系统开发指南

ZIP文件

下载需积分: 49 | 685KB | 更新于2025-01-05 | 6 浏览量 | 19 下载量 举报 收藏
download 立即下载
知识点概述: 1. Vue3.0框架应用:本系统采用最新的Vue.js版本——Vue3.0,它带来了更多的功能改进和性能优化,如响应式系统、Composition API等。 2. Element UI组件库:系统基于Element UI进行开发,这是一个基于Vue 2.0的桌面端组件库,提供了一整套的组件来快速搭建用户界面。 3. vue-cli3脚手架:使用Vue.js官方的脚手架工具vue-cli3来构建项目,该工具能帮助开发者快速生成项目结构,管理依赖和配置。 4. 前端功能实现:系统实现了包括登录/注册、仪表板、头部选项卡路由切换、表单组件、图片上传及裁剪、富文本编辑器、markdown编辑器、列表处理、报表打印、Echart图表、消息中心、拖拽功能、自定义图标、国际化支持、权限测试、404/403页面以及三级菜单等多项前端功能。 5. 主题色切换:系统支持手动切换主题色,并允许使用自定义主题色,提高了界面的可配置性和用户体验。 6. 打包与部署:系统支持不同环境下的打包,并且考虑到性能优化与部署。 详细知识点说明: - Vue.js基础:Vue.js是一种轻量级的JavaScript框架,专注于视图层,遵循MVVM模式。Vue3.0相较于Vue2.x,增强了响应式系统,引入了Composition API等新特性。 - Element UI组件库:Element是饿了么前端团队推出的一个基于Vue 2.x的桌面端组件库,为开发者提供了一套丰富的界面组件,支持快速构建高质量的Web界面。 - vue-cli3脚手架:vue-cli3是一个官方提供的快速搭建Vue项目的基础工具。它提供了一个基于Node.js的命令行界面,可以快速创建Vue项目、管理依赖关系和配置。 - 登录/注册界面:登录/注册是后台管理系统的重要组成部分,通常涉及到用户认证和授权。系统需要安全地处理用户名、密码等敏感信息,并提供用户友好的交互方式。 - 仪表板(Dashboard):仪表板是用户进行数据分析和管理的中心界面,它集成了各种统计图表和信息模块,帮助用户快速获得关键业务数据的概览。 - 路由切换与宽度自适应:在后台管理系统中,用户可能需要在多个页面间切换。系统支持头部选项卡路由切换,并且超过扩展时自动计算宽度,还提供了关闭缩小、关闭其他或关闭全部的功能,提高空间利用率和操作便捷性。 - 表单和数据处理:表单是后台管理系统中进行数据输入和提交的主要界面。系统提供了多种表单用法,如数据验证、图片上传及裁剪、富文本和markdown编辑器等,以满足不同的业务需求。 - 列表处理和报表打印:列表用于展示和管理数据集合,系统提供了多种列表用法,包括数据的增删改查操作。同时,系统支持报表打印功能,方便用户获取数据的硬拷贝。 - 图表与数据分析:Echart是一个开源的JavaScript图表库,本系统集成了Echart组件,用于展示丰富的图表类型,帮助用户对数据进行直观的可视化分析。 - 消息中心:在大型后台系统中,消息中心用于显示系统通知、用户消息等,提醒用户注意重要信息或操作。 - 拖拽功能:拖拽是提高用户交互体验的重要方式,系统支持列表拖拽排序和可拖拽弹窗,方便用户按照个人习惯或业务逻辑定制界面。 - 自定义图标和国际化:系统支持自定义图标,允许用户上传和使用自定义的图标集,适应不同的品牌风格。国际化支持则允许系统轻松地切换到不同的语言环境,适应多语言用户的需要。 - 权限测试与菜单管理:权限测试涉及到用户权限的管理与控制,系统中实现了404/403等页面提示,以及三级菜单功能,方便管理不同级别的权限与菜单项。 - 打包与部署:考虑到不同环境的需求,系统提供了不同环境的打包功能,以及一键安装步骤,便于开发者进行环境配置和部署上线。 以上知识点均为构建一个功能完备的后台管理系统所需了解和掌握的核心要素,通过这些知识点的学习与实践,开发者可以高效地构建出专业水准的管理系统。

相关推荐

WiwiChow
  • 粉丝: 46
上传资源 快速赚钱